Amazon Coupons

What can be better than Amazon Coupons for an avid Amazon shopper? It is the biggest e-commerce platform that practically sells everything under the sun. Therefore, it makes sense to get coupons to save on a variety of purchases from this website.

You can find the Coupons Section on Amazon’s website and browse through the various coupons offered in each category. Coupons are also organized by brand which makes it easier to find what you need. Once you find the coupon you want, just clip it and add the items to your cart. The discount will be automatically applied when you go to check out.

Ibotta

Ibotta is one of the best places to get cashback on individual products from different retailers. For this, first, you need to log in to the Ibotta website or app. Then find the retailer you are going to buy from and go through the available cashback offers.

Select the coupons you want to use, shop with the retailer, and make sure that Ibotta receives a copy of the receipt. It will add the cashback to your account which you can further send to your bank account or to PayPal. You can also cash it out as a gift card.

Ibotta also has a browser extension that sends out notifications if a cashback offer is available.

BeFrugal

BeFrugal is a browser extension that can help you save serious money while shopping. It is available for free on Chrome, Firefox, Edge, and Safari and does not even need you to search for coupons. You will automatically receive them if you shop via the BeFrugal extension.

With this, you can receive up to 40% cash back at over 5,000 stores. Apart from that, the site also offers a $10 sign-up bonus.

Fetch

Fetch does not directly give you coupons but instead transfers points after you submit your shopping receipts. These points can then be redeemed to get gift cards. 

It is also super easy to use as all you have to download the app and create an account. After that, connect your e-mail, Amazon, and Walmart accounts and upload receipts for the last 14 calendar days. Your receipts would be scanned and points added to your account.

Once you earn enough points, you can redeem them for gift cards or sweepstakes entries. You can use Fetch’s Offers page to keep track of when points are available for certain purchases.

Capital One Shopping

Capital One Shopping is also a browser extension that works with pretty much all major browsers like Chrome, Firefox, and Safari. You can install it and then shop normally while it searches online for discounts. The discounts will then be automatically applied at checkout to help you save money.

PayPal Honey

What if we told you that everyone’s favorite PayPal also has a browser extension for discounts? Yes, PayPal Honey is an extension and mobile app that can get you discounts while shopping online. Once you install it, it will search for available coupon codes that will be applied when you go to check out. Some purchases may also qualify for PayPal Reward points which can be later redeemed for cash back.

With the PayPal Honey app, you can also track prices and top reward rates and get notifications for sales.

Groupon

Groupon is the best option to get discounts on local services and activities. For this, either browse the Groupon website or download the app to find exclusive deals for businesses in your area. 

Once you log in and enter your location, you will be able to see discounts for local amusement parks, beauty salons, or car repair shops. This is something you will not get on other coupon websites or apps. You just have to click on a deal to get it and then choose buy to make the payment.

RetailMeNot

If you want cash back on full purchase amounts, RetailMeNot is the way to go. It has a website, browser extension, and mobile app that find the best deals and discounts for you. You can explore the cash-back offers and promos or search for a specific retailer to see the available coupons.

The retailer notifies RetailMeNot after you checkout and then your cash back is issued. This can then be transferred to Venmo or PayPal. These cash-back offers can also be stacked with free shipping deals and other promos which is a big plus.

Coupons.com

Are you an old-fashioned shopper who prefers having physical coupons for shopping? Then Coupons.com might just be the thing you’re looking for. It is a site that has click-and-print coupons for everything from snacks to shampoo.

 Coupons.com also offers paperless coupons via its app that you can use to save money during your shopping trips. You can subscribe to its emails to automatically receive alerts and new offers.

Flipp

Flipp is good for finding deals on local products and retailers. First, you have to visit the website or download the app. Then enter your ZIP code and you will get weekly product ads from stores in the area near you. If you find a deal you like, click on it and then Flipp will find the product in the store nearest to you.

Swagbucks

Swagbucks operates a little differently than other coupon sites. Here, you earn points for shopping online, playing games, and taking surveys which you can then turn into gift cards. You get Swagbucks for every $1 you spend with any of its 1,500 retail partners.

This gives you access to the best deals and coupons for retailers like Amazon, Macy’s, and Starbucks

TopCashback

The biggest advantage of TopCashback is that it offers a cash-back guarantee. This means that it matches the cash-back rates offered by its competitors and also has no payout restrictions. There are 19 payout options and a 5% bonus if you opt for gift cards.

You can also combine the cash-back with other promos and coupon codes on TopCashback.
